Nimrod was located on the Gulf Coast.

Nimrod would have been located within present day Liberty County<2>.

While the community is gone, the present day location for Nimrod is 120 feet [37 m] above sea level.<3>.

Time Zone: The area where Nimrod was located is in the Central Time Zone (CST/CDT) and observes daylight saving time

Using our Gazetteer, we found that there are two Texas communities named Nimrod: This one is located in Liberty County and the other is located in Eastland County.

Beyond Texas, there are 9 communities that are also named Nimrod - they are located in Arkansas, Minnesota, Missouri, Montana (2), Newfoundland and Labrador, North Carolina and Oregon.
